WebFeb 7, 2024 · Common causes of pink or red urine are: Current UTI with hematuria. Medications include Pyridium (phenazopyridine) or foods that may cause red urine. Blood in the urine (hematuria) for any other cause may cause pink (if mild) or red urine (if moderate or severe bleeding). Strenuous workouts or sports (exercise-induced hematuria). Urine gets its yellow color from urobilin or urochrome, a chemical that is produced when your body breaks down red blood cells. Your kidneys then remove this chemical from the blood, combine it with water, and excrete it as urine.
